Experience the warmth of Bedouin hospitality during this desert retreat to the Kfar Hanokdim village. Learn about life in the Kana’im valley through food, ceremony & adventure.
This day tour combines the excitement of discovering kibbutz culture & fascinating wildlife. You’ll visit the Yotvata Kibbutz, one of the many communities across Israel, to learn about the member’s day-to-day lives. As this kibbutz is most notable for its dairy production, you’ll have the opportunity to try some local ice cream. That’s not all though. You'll see species that have existed since biblical times on a safari at the Hai Bar Wildlife Reserve.

On a parcel of land that was once part of the ancient town of Magdala sits the Magdala Center, an impressive facility dedicated to the work of Jesus Christ. This tour of the center is a chance to discover the city’s rich history as well as learn more about the center’s Christian mission.
